Transaction 03333eff81c32dcf123ffe2b836c5059ce593ad23b4a3fc0ba174ed52c0cf876
1 Input
1 Output
-
03333eff81c32dcf123ffe2b836c5059ce593ad23b4a3fc0ba174ed52c0cf876:0
- value
- 85000
- script pubkey
- OP_0 OP_PUSHBYTES_20 f77379e272998487c9f3d0957d910533734ea4de
- address
- bc1q7aehncnjnxzg0j0n6z2hmyg9xde5afx74ndyqv